Responsibilities
Act as a leader in applying Cost Competitive Execution techniques and develop the most cost-effective total project solution for the discipline engineering work
Establish, track, and monitor material key quantities; provide analysis and forecasts
Develop and review specifications, including design criteria
Participate in activities associated with equipment and material procurement, permitting, and subcontracting
Perform and check calculations, specify equipment, and solve problems of difficult engineering complexity
Serve as Supervising Lead providing guidance/supervision to other leads and function as mentor to less experienced engineers including performance appraisal input and counseling
Analyze and make independent recommendations regarding solutions to problems with varying complexity in accordance with organization and/or project objectives and guidelines

Qualifications
Must be a U.S. Citizen or U.S. Permanent Resident
Bachelor’s degree in Nuclear or Mechanical Engineering, and 16 years of experience in equipment or systems related engineering.
Minimum 3 years of experience in the Nuclear Island area equipment.
Experience in developing technical specifications and procurement documents for Nuclear Island support systems within Reactor Building and Radioactive Waste Building systems.
Working knowledge of industry codes, standards, and regulations that apply to mechanical engineering design of nuclear power plants, including NRC regulations.
Understanding of ASME NQA-1 standards for nuclear quality assurance and ability to implement and maintain quality assurance programs in compliance with ASME NQA-1 requirements.
Working knowledge of ASME BPVC Section III design.
Advanced Knowledge
Design of mechanical equipment through all stages of a project from conceptual phase to design development, construction, and commissioning
Mechanical equipment in one or more of the following specialties: rotating equipment, pressure vessels, unfired and fired heat transfer equipment, or packaged equipment
